Output 4095512db6193f0e54696526dc89b3e2880f408ce12cb68800c2426f1272c402:4

value
64188723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 366bde1a395ff9c9acd4ca42136dd6e871974bd0 OP_EQUAL
address
MCruwZTUtaP4YwZ91FxesmkHTrX5dr3nzK
transaction
4095512db6193f0e54696526dc89b3e2880f408ce12cb68800c2426f1272c402
spent
true